York Explore Library and Archive

York's flagship public library and home of the City Archive housed in a beautiful listed building by renowned York architect Walter Brierley.
Location: Library Square, Museum Street, York, YO1 7DS

About Us

Drop-in, browse and borrow books, use the computers or printers , or make use of our quiet study spaces on the first floor. Discover the history and heritage of York in our internationally important Archive and if you have a question we are always happy to help and advise.

You can chill out in our spacious, family friendly cafe serving delicious coffee and hot drinks, locally made cakes and treats, snacks and light meals. The cafe area doubles as a space to discover new artists with changing exhibitions through the year.

We are an accessible, disabled friendly library. Our customer lift gives access to the first floor study space, Archives. and Local History collection. For full accessibility information check our listing on Accessable.
